i meant instead of the acog. Magnified optics aren't great for up close engagements. It can be done but it takes training. The acog is great for medium distance shooting, but not close stuff. Thats why the military uses the minidots on top of them. Aimpoints and eotechs are made to shoot with both eyes open which is good since both of your eyes will be stuck wide open under stress. But if it's not going to be used up close then it's nothing to worry about.
